TENAA, a certification agency in China, has flagged the Vivo Y78+ on its platform, indicating that the smartphone will soon be available in the Chinese market. Some key details about the phone from the listing are as follows.

The TENAA file quotes Y78 plus' battery size to be 4900mAh. Vivo is likely to round that figure to 5000mAh in advertising. It's a standard-sized cell serving most of the mid-range smartphones in the market.
The document also verified that the newcomer is imminent with three cameras on the back. However, the sensor inside the rear lens setup remains a mystery. Hardware information on such listings is usually vague; still, they indicate an imminent launch in respective origins. It's going to be a brand new addition to the Vivo price catalog.
To quote gossip around this device, Vivo Y78+ will likely limit its retail to China. Fans should expect the Vanilla Y78 option to go official for global markets. Apart from these early rumors, nothing interesting has surfaced regarding the phone specification, but we anticipate vital info and images will emerge online soon.

Extending today's news, Vivo Y11 2023 is in the works. It has surfaced in leaks with specifications and will soon go official. It offers an FHD+ display, an MTK processor, a 5000mAh cell, 4GB RAM, up to 128GB storage, 18W power delivery, and an Android 13 operating system right out of the gate. It will serve as an entry-level contender. There's little to know about Y11's and Y78+'s launch dates; we'll report them to you as soon as we get a hint.
